|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Product Name | PVC End Cap |
| Size Range | 20 mm – 315 mm |
| Material | High-grade uPVC |
| Connection Type | Solvent Weld |
| Color | Grey (custom colors available) |
| Pressure Rating | PN 10 / PN 16 (dependent on pipe system) |
| Temperature Range | −10°C to +60°C |
| Chemical Resistance | Resistant to salts, acids, alkalis, and industrial chemicals |
| Fire Behavior | Self-extinguishing |
| Installation Type | Underground & above-ground applications |
| Compliance | ASTM, ISO, GCC, and Saudi municipal standards |
| Service Life | 30–50 years |

Ensure that the pipe ends are clean, dry, and without any burs or debris prior to use.
Apply an even layer of PVC solvent cement to the inside surface of the end cap and the outside surface of the PVC pipe.
Push the end cap fully over the pipe with a slight twisting motion to ensure even distribution of the solvent.
Press and hold the joint together for some seconds, and allow adequate time for the cure as per manufacturer instructions for maximum bonding efficiency.
Verify correct alignment and bond before backfilling, as well as pressurization, if appropriate.

1. What is a PVC end cap used for?
It is used to seal the open end of PVC pipes and conduits to prevent leaks and contamination.
2. What sizes are available?
PVC end caps are available from 20 mm to 315 mm.
3. How is a PVC end cap installed?
Using solvent weld cement, creating a permanent and leak-proof joint.
4. Can PVC end caps be used underground?
Yes, they are suitable for both underground and above-ground installations.
5. Are PVC end caps pressure-rated?
Yes, when matched with compatible pipes, they support PN 10 and PN 16 systems.
6. Are they resistant to chemicals?
Yes, uPVC offers excellent resistance to acids, salts, and alkalis.
7. Can end caps be removed later?
Solvent-welded end caps are permanent; removal requires cutting the pipe.
8. Are they approved for GCC projects?
Yes, they comply with ASTM, ISO, and GCC standards.
9. What is the lifespan of a PVC end cap?
Typically 30–50 years under normal operating conditions.
10. Are PVC end caps environmentally friendly?
Yes, they are recyclable and support sustainable infrastructure practices.

| Feature | PVC End Cap | HDPE End Cap |
|---|---|---|
| Application | PVC conduit systems | HDPE ducts and corrugated ducts |
| Material Rigidity | High rigidity | Flexible and impact resistant |
| Typical Use | Electrical conduits and structured duct banks | Telecom ducts and underground fiber routes |
| Durability | Resistant to corrosion and chemicals | Highly resistant to soil stress |
